The exotic homeland of Oscar de La Renta, the Dominican Republic, is a source of inspiration for his gorgeous floral fragrances.
Island Flowers is a harmony of hibiscus and freesia flowers, with fresh citrusy opening of orange and mandarin. The sensual base unites vanilla, cedar and musk. Island Flowers was created in 2006.
